Understanding DIN Standards: DIN 32757 Data Destruction

When it comes to data security and information destruction, following established standards is crucial to ensure compliance and effectively safeguard sensitive information. One such standard that is widely recognized in the industry is DIN 32757, specifically focusing on data destruction processes.

DIN (Deutsches Institut für Normung - German Institute for Standardization) is the German national organization responsible for defining technical standards across various industries. DIN 32757 sets guidelines and specifications for the destruction of data carriers to prevent unauthorized access to confidential data.

The primary objective of DIN 32757 is to ensure the complete and irreversible destruction of data stored on different types of media, including paper documents, CDs, hard drives, and other storage devices. By adhering to the regulations outlined in this standard, organizations can mitigate the risk of data breaches and protect sensitive information from falling into the wrong hands.

Key Aspects of DIN 32757 Data Destruction:

1. Destruction Methods: DIN 32757 outlines specific methods for data destruction based on the type of media being handled. This includes shredding paper documents into fine particles, degaussing magnetic storage devices to erase data, and physically destroying electronic media to render it unreadable.

2. Security Levels: The standard classifies data destruction processes into different security levels based on the sensitivity of the information being handled. This helps organizations determine the appropriate level of protection required for different types of data.

3. Documentation and Compliance: DIN 32757 also emphasizes the importance of maintaining records and documentation of the data destruction process. This documentation serves as proof of compliance with the standard and demonstrates that proper procedures were followed to safeguard information.

4. Environmental Considerations: In addition to data security aspects, DIN 32757 also addresses environmental concerns related to data destruction. It encourages recycling and proper disposal practices to minimize the impact on the environment.

By following the guidelines set forth by DIN 32757, organizations can establish robust data destruction protocols that align with international best practices. This not only helps protect sensitive information but also enhances trust with customers, partners, and regulatory authorities.

In conclusion, DIN 32757 Data Destruction standard plays a vital role in ensuring the secure and effective disposal of confidential data. By incorporating these guidelines into their data management strategies, organizations can strengthen their data security posture and uphold the integrity of their information assets.
